
tariff实战案例用关税机制优化你的Python开发工作流【免费下载链接】tariffThe official repository for tariff项目地址: https://gitcode.com/gh_mirrors/ta/tarifftariff是一款创新的Python工具它通过模拟关税机制来优化你的开发工作流帮助你更好地管理和控制Python包的导入成本。这款工具允许你为不同的Python包设置关税税率从而影响它们的导入速度让你在开发过程中更加关注代码的效率和依赖管理。 什么是tarifftariff的核心功能是让你能够对Python包的导入施加关税。当你为某个包设置关税后导入该包时会根据关税百分比增加导入时间并显示关税提示信息。这一独特机制可以帮助开发团队识别过度依赖的第三方库优化项目的启动时间提高代码的执行效率培养更合理的依赖使用习惯 快速开始安装与基础配置一键安装步骤使用pip可以轻松安装tariffpip install tariff基础配置示例安装完成后你可以通过简单的代码设置关税规则。以下是一个基本示例import tariff # 设置关税税率包名: 百分比 tariff.set({ numpy: 50, # 对numpy征收50%关税 pandas: 200, # 对pandas征收200%关税 requests: 150 # 对requests征收150%关税 }) 实战案例优化你的Python项目示例场景设置让我们通过example.py中的完整示例来了解tariff的实际应用#!/usr/bin/env python3 Example usage of the tariff package. import tariff print(Setting tariffs on packages...) tariff.set({ time: 50, # 50%关税 os: 100, # 100%关税 sys: 200 # 200%关税 }) print(\nImporting packages with tariffs:) import time import os import sys print(\nImporting a package without tariffs:) import json print(\nDemo completed! Make importing great again! )关税机制如何工作当你导入设置了关税的包时tariff会执行以下操作记录正常的导入时间根据关税百分比延长导入时间显示关税提示信息让你清楚了解导入成本这种机制可以让团队在开发过程中直观地感受到不同依赖的成本从而做出更明智的技术选择。 最佳实践如何有效使用tariff确定关税策略对大型库设置较高关税鼓励团队寻找轻量级替代方案对非必要的第三方库设置关税减少项目依赖对频繁使用的核心库设置低关税或免税保证开发效率监控和调整定期检查项目中的导入模式根据实际情况调整关税设置。你可以通过分析导入时间数据发现可以优化的依赖关系从而提高整体项目性能。 深入学习与资源要了解更多关于tariff的高级用法和实现细节可以查看项目源码主程序入口tariff/main.py核心功能实现tariff/init.py 参与贡献tariff是一个开源项目欢迎通过以下方式参与贡献克隆仓库git clone https://gitcode.com/gh_mirrors/ta/tariff提交issue报告bug或提出功能建议提交pull request贡献代码通过tariff让我们一起优化Python开发工作流打造更高效、更轻量的项目【免费下载链接】tariffThe official repository for tariff项目地址: https://gitcode.com/gh_mirrors/ta/tariff创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考